Defining the Modern Coastal Farmhouse Bathroom Aesthetic

The modern coastal farmhouse bathroom aesthetic seamlessly blends rustic charm, coastal influences, and contemporary design, creating a space that is both inviting and stylish. This unique blend evokes a sense of tranquility and relaxation, reminiscent of a beach house with a touch of modern sophistication.

Natural Materials and Textures

Natural materials play a crucial role in achieving the modern coastal farmhouse bathroom aesthetic. Wood, stone, and linen are commonly used to create a welcoming and airy ambiance.

  • Wood: Reclaimed wood beams, shiplap walls, and wooden vanities add a rustic touch, while light-toned wood floors create a sense of warmth and spaciousness.
  • Stone: Natural stone tiles, such as marble or slate, bring a touch of elegance and sophistication. They can be used for shower walls, floors, or countertops, adding a luxurious feel.
  • Linen: Soft linen towels and bath mats create a cozy and inviting atmosphere. Linen’s natural texture adds a touch of rustic charm while complementing the overall coastal farmhouse style.

Color Palette

The color palette for a modern coastal farmhouse bathroom is typically light and airy, drawing inspiration from the natural surroundings.

  • Light Blues and Greens: These colors evoke the feeling of the ocean and nature, adding a calming and refreshing touch.
  • Whites: White walls and fixtures create a sense of spaciousness and brightness, allowing the natural materials and textures to take center stage.
  • Natural Wood Tones: The warm tones of natural wood complement the light blues and greens, creating a balanced and inviting atmosphere.

Design Elements and Features

The modern coastal farmhouse bathroom aesthetic is a harmonious blend of rustic charm, contemporary functionality, and seaside serenity. It involves a careful selection of design elements and features that contribute to the overall ambiance.

Shiplap Walls and Reclaimed Wood Accents

Shiplap walls, a staple of farmhouse design, add texture and visual interest to the bathroom space. Their horizontal lines create a sense of warmth and coziness, reminiscent of a classic farmhouse. Reclaimed wood accents, such as beams, shelves, or vanity tops, introduce a rustic element that complements the shiplap walls. These elements are often left in their natural state, showcasing the wood’s unique grain patterns and imperfections, adding character and a sense of history to the space.

Coastal-Inspired Accessories

Coastal-inspired accessories are essential for bringing the seaside ambiance into the bathroom. These accessories can include:

  • Seashell-shaped soap dishes or toothbrush holders
  • Nautical-themed towels or rugs
  • Coastal-inspired artwork featuring seascapes, lighthouses, or boats
  • Driftwood accents or sculptures

These elements subtly introduce the coastal theme without being overwhelming, creating a calming and relaxing atmosphere.

Modern Fixtures and Finishes

While embracing the farmhouse aesthetic, modern coastal farmhouse bathrooms also incorporate contemporary fixtures and finishes. This includes:

  • Sleek, minimalist faucets with clean lines and brushed nickel or chrome finishes
  • Contemporary lighting fixtures, such as pendant lights or sconces, that provide both ambient and task lighting
  • Minimalist vanities with simple, geometric designs and clean lines

These modern elements provide a touch of sophistication and functionality, balancing the rustic charm of the farmhouse style.

Natural Light and Ventilation

Natural light is crucial in creating a bright and inviting bathroom space. Large windows or skylights allow ample sunlight to flood the room, enhancing the sense of spaciousness and creating a cheerful atmosphere. Proper ventilation is equally important, ensuring fresh air circulation and preventing moisture buildup. This can be achieved through exhaust fans or strategically placed windows.

Creating a Functional and Relaxing Space: Modern Coastal Farmhouse Bathroom

A modern coastal farmhouse bathroom should be more than just aesthetically pleasing; it should be a sanctuary that promotes relaxation and rejuvenation. To achieve this, it’s crucial to create a functional layout that prioritizes both practicality and comfort. This means optimizing storage, maximizing space, and incorporating features that enhance the overall experience.

Optimizing Storage and Maximizing Space

A well-organized bathroom is essential for maintaining a sense of calm and order. Consider incorporating clever storage solutions that make the most of every inch of space. This could include built-in cabinets, floating shelves, or even a stylish ladder for towels. By strategically utilizing vertical space, you can create a clutter-free environment that feels spacious and inviting.

Incorporating Practical Features

Practical features play a significant role in enhancing the functionality of a bathroom. A walk-in shower offers easy accessibility and can be designed with multiple showerheads for a luxurious spa-like experience. A freestanding tub provides a focal point for relaxation, while ample counter space ensures there’s room for toiletries, decorative items, and even a small plant.

Enhancing Tranquility with Natural Elements, Modern coastal farmhouse bathroom

Bringing the outdoors in is a key element of the coastal farmhouse aesthetic. Incorporating natural elements, such as houseplants, can create a sense of tranquility and connection to nature. Plants like ferns, succulents, or orchids thrive in humid environments and add a touch of life to the space. Natural stone accents, such as marble or granite, can also contribute to the calming ambiance. The cool, tactile quality of natural stone complements the coastal farmhouse style and adds a touch of elegance.
